A. New Market Tax Credit Update
Consultant Paul Breckenridge gave an update of the New Market Tax Credit
(NMTC), He presenfed handouts to the Committee outlining the Conventional
and Greenbridge Structure. ;
;
He stated there is a very real chance that Congress will not reauthorize the ~
NMTC program for 2011:; 1Nithout a reauthbrization of the program, there is
basically no chance that we will be.able to use NMTC's for the project. ;

Even if the program is reauthorized, given the complexity of the "Green.bridge"
structure that we would need to employ, our only realistic chance is if King
County Housing Authority (KCHA) receives an allocation award, as KCHA has
committed to our project.
The Committee will diseuss. altemative strategies at the next Committee
meeting in the event the NMTC.approach is unsuccessful.

C. Activity Center Construction Update
Manager Burke gave an updafe on the construction of the Activity Center.
Construction-started June 7, 2010; current scHeduled substantial completion is
February 7, 2011 and contract completion date isApril 7, 2011. It is currently
12% complete.
_ ' Pervious concrete test panel is scheduled for Tuesday, September 14, 2010.
The initial pervious concrete subcontractor.was removed from the project for not meeting minimum certification requirements. The replacement contractor is
ConcreteMan, fne. of Puyallup.
Sub-grade for pervious paving has been inspected/approved by Geotechnical
Consultant.
A walk off mat at the gym covered walkway door; and reduced lighting at the.
parking lof are required by`tlie Leadership in Energy'and Environmental Design
(LEED) certification process.
We are currently on track for LEED gold certification even though: we are not
adding any addifional construction costs beyond our original target of LEED
silver.
